A hybrid meta-heuristic algorithm for the vehicle routing problem with stochastic travel times considering the driver's satisfaction


  • Alireza Salamat-Bakhsh Department of Industrial Engineering, Tehran South Branch, Islamic Azad University Tehran, Iran
  • Mehdi Alinaghian Department of Industrial and Systems Engineering, Isfahan University of Technology, Isfahan, Iran
  • Narges Norouzi Department of Industrial Engineering, College of Engineering, University of Tehran, Tehran, Iran
  • Reza Tavakkoli-Moghaddam Department of Industrial Engineering, College of Engineering, University of Tehran, Tehran, Iran

A vehicle routing problem is a significant problem that has attracted great attention from researchers in recent years. The main objectives of the vehicle routing problem are to minimize the traveled distance, total traveling time, number of vehicles and cost function of transportation. Reducing these variables leads to decreasing the total cost and increasing the driver's satisfaction level. On the other hand, this satisfaction, which will decrease by increasing the service time, is considered as an important logistic problem for a company. The stochastic time dominated by a probability variable leads to variation of the service time, while it is ignored in classical routing problems. This paper investigates the problem of the increasing service time by using the stochastic time for each tour such that the total traveling time of the vehicles is limited to a specific limit based on a defined probability. Since exact solutions of the vehicle routing problem that belong to the category of NP-hard problems are not practical in a large scale, a hybrid algorithm based on simulated annealing with genetic operators was proposed to obtain an efficient solution with reasonable computational cost and time. Finally, for some small cases, the related results of the proposed algorithm were compared with results obtained by the Lingo 8 software. The obtained results indicate the efficiency of the proposed hybrid simulated annealing algorithm.

